Responsibilities

Drive the day-to-day execution of a transformation effort to help clients achieve new performance highs in their business
Apply a proven, methodology-driven approach to large-scale transformation that focuses on execution and capability building
Take ownership of specific workstreams and end-products within the overall transformation program
Deliver the transformation objectives within your workstream, coaching clients to develop and execute effective improvement plans
Role-model a mindset of rapid decision-making and mobilize clients to achieve change that exceeds their expectations
Build on proven capabilities and leverage a range of influencing styles, ranging from respected 'hard-edge' manager to motivational coach
Inspire others, build strong relationships, and display high energy and resilience in ambiguous and fast-paced contexts
Work closely with others in a collaborative team setting but also operate autonomously with limited direction to drive progress in areas of accountability

Required

Bachelor's degree is required, advanced degree (MBA) is strongly preferred, with an outstanding record of academic achievement
5+ years of corporate and/or professional services experience focused on operations, finance/accounting, and or go-to-market/top-line growth initiatives
Ability to understand, analyze and interpret financial statements
Demonstrated aptitude for analytical and conceptual problem solving, comfort with quantitative analysis and managerial accounting
Ability to work effectively with people at all levels in an organization
Ability to understand the perspectives of varied stakeholder groups
Ability to communicate complex ideas effectively, both verbally and in writing, in English and the local office language(s)
Willingness to travel, over 50%

Preferred

Advanced degree (MBA) is strongly preferred
Experience in management consulting, large-scale change management, turnaround and restructurings, M&A and integrations, and or investment banking is a plus
Program management experience on driving large-scale, transformational change programs is preferred
Experience in the following is ideal: implementing rapid and successful operational turnarounds and or rapid growth programs across key strategic, revenue, cost and working capital levers, business planning or P&L modeling, working capital management, or 13-week cashflow preparation
